Man hospitalised after shooting in Limerick

Gardaí are examining a burnt-out vehicle to establish if it was connected to the incident

A man is receiving treatment at University Hospital Limerick after a shooting in Limerick city.

The man in his 30s was hospitalised after the incident, which happened at around 3pm.

A man in his late 20s has been arrested in connection with the shooting.

He is being held at Roxboro Road Garda Station.

Gardaí are also examining a burnt-out Suzuki Vitara which was found in a back alley at Kennedy Park in the Roxboro area to establish if it was connected to the incident.
